Magnesium is necessary for over 300 chemical reactions in the body. Foods high in fiber contain magnesium, including legumes, vegetables, nuts and whole grains. This mineral is used to treat high cholesterol, ADHD, fatigue, migraines, PMS and multiple sclerosis. Magnesium can also be applied topically to speed up healing.

Glucosamine treats a variety of joint pain issues. This supplement is made from seashells and shark cartilage. Patients have reported glucosamine supplements help relieve knee pain, back pain, glaucoma and the pain associated with osteoarthritis and rheumatoid arthritis; however, there is not sufficient medical evidence to support these claims.
